Primary Responsibilities
- Perform routine field maintenance as well as the commissioning and start-up of new facilities.
- Respond and provide automation support during outages.
- Support the daily operations of the business unit through the installation, programming, start-up and maintenance of automation and process control equipment.
- Develop control strategies, provide input to P&IDs, control system specifications, termination diagrams, commissioning plans.
- Work closely with Operations, Engineering, Maintenance, Information Technology Groups.
- Understand and follow MOC processes to ensure proper PLC Program updates and changes.
- Conduct activities in line with internal procedures, legislation, and industry standards.
- Pursue continuous professional development and maintain a high degree of discipline knowledge and awareness.
- Work in a safe manner at all times and report all health and safety incidents and concerns.
- Add additional duties as required.
Required Skills
- Must possess a high level of competency regarding the programming, configuring, and troubleshooting of various PLC’s/RTU’s such as Allen Bradley, Emerson ROC, ABB Totalflow, Scadapak.
- Knowledge of Modbus communication protocol.
- Experience in configuring and troubleshooting radio communications leveraging multiple types of communication protocols.
- Experience in troubleshooting and calibrating various types of instrumentation.
- Knowledge of P&ID’s.
- Competency in reading and developing Cause & Effect documents.
- Proficiency in Instrumentation and Low Voltage Electrical Systems.
- Adeptness in Upstream and Midstream Oil and Gas Processes.
- Education on how changes to the process impact Control System programming and ability to clearly communicate and work with Corporate Engineering to solve problems.
